Poles are helping Ukrainians just as they help their neighbours and friends, and this is something that is needed very much, Mateusz Morawiecki, the prime minister of Poland, said on Saturday.
Polish President Andrzej Duda, after his meeting with visiting US counterpart Joe Biden, described his country's alliance with the US as "strong."
Poland seeks faster supplies of US military equipment, Polish President Andrzej Duda has said after his meeting with his US counterpart Joe Biden.
US President Joe Biden told his Polish counterpart Andrzej Duda during their Warsaw talks on Saturday that he views Nato's Article 5 guarantee of mutual defence between member-states as a "sacred" obligation.
Poland wants to buy modern US-made military equipment and is interested in cooperation with the United States in the military field, Polish President Andrzej Duda told his visiting US counterpart Joe Biden during a meeting in Warsaw on Saturday.

The Presidents of Poland and the US, Andrzej Duda and Joe Biden, are holding face-to-face talks on the war in Ukraine, in Warsaw on Saturday.
Since February 24, when Russia invaded Ukraine, 2.268 million people have crossed the Polish-Ukrainian border into Poland, the Border Guard (SG) tweeted on Saturday morning.
Poland has become the focal point of American military support for Ukraine, but also the first shelter for millions of refugees fleeing the war in Ukraine, the French daily Le Figaro wrote on Saturday.
US President Joe Biden's visit to Poland shows a new reality in which Poland suddenly takes centre stage and becomes a linchpin of Western solidarity and security, the New York Times wrote on Friday.
